The Cookie Bar WordPress plugin before version 1.8.9 is vulnerable to Stored Cross-Site Scripting (XSS), allowing high privilege users to execute XSS attacks. Learn more about the impact and mitigation.
The Cookie Bar WordPress plugin before version 1.8.9 is vulnerable to a Stored Cross-Site Scripting (XSS) issue that could be exploited by high privilege users, allowing them to perform XSS attacks.
Understanding CVE-2021-24653
This CVE involves a security vulnerability in the Cookie Bar plugin for WordPress, potentially leading to Cross-Site Scripting attacks.
What is CVE-2021-24653?
The vulnerability in the Cookie Bar plugin version prior to 1.8.9 arises from improper sanitization of the Cookie Bar Message setting, enabling privileged users to execute XSS attacks despite restrictions.
The Impact of CVE-2021-24653
The impact of this vulnerability is significant as it may allow attackers with high privileges to inject malicious scripts into the website, leading to potential data theft, defacement, or account takeover.
Technical Details of CVE-2021-24653
In-depth technical details surrounding the vulnerability and its implications.
Vulnerability Description
The issue lies in the failure to properly sanitize user input for the Cookie Bar Message setting, exposing the site to XSS attacks even when unfiltered_html permissions are restricted.
Affected Systems and Versions
The affected version is Cookie Bar plugin less than 1.8.9, indicating that sites using versions prior to this are at risk of exploitation.
Exploitation Mechanism
By leveraging the vulnerability in the Cookie Bar plugin, attackers can bypass security measures and inject malicious scripts into web pages, ultimately compromising user data or site functionality.
Mitigation and Prevention
Steps to mitigate and prevent the exploitation of CVE-2021-24653.
Immediate Steps to Take
Website administrators are advised to update the Cookie Bar plugin to version 1.8.9 or higher to patch the vulnerability and prevent potential XSS attacks.
Long-Term Security Practices
Implement regular security audits and ensure all plugins and themes are regularly updated to address known vulnerabilities and enhance overall site security.
Patching and Updates
Stay informed about security patches released by plugin developers and promptly apply updates to ensure your WordPress site is protected against known vulnerabilities.